程序性细胞死亡因子 4基因对川崎病血清诱导血管内皮细胞凋亡的影响
Effect of siRNA interference with PDCD4 gene on apoptosis of vascular endothelial cells induced by kawasaki disease serum

英文摘要:
      Objective To study the role of PDCD4 in the apoptosis of vascular endothelial cells induced by serum from patients with Kawasaki disease.Methods The research period was from March 2017 to April 2018.The serum of patients with Kawasakidiseasewas collected and used to culture vascular endothelial cells from The First Affiliated Hospital of Shaoyang University.Real?time PCR and Western blot were used to detect the expression of PDCD4 in cells.into Vascular endothelial cells was transfectedwith PDCD4 siRNA,and then cultured with Kawasaki disease serum.Realtime PCR and Western blot were used to detect the ex? pression level of PDCD4 in cells.MTT assay was used to detect cell proliferation and apoptosis was detected by flow cytometry.Western blot was used to detect the level of C?Caspase?3 and C?Caspase?9 protein in the cells.Results The expression of PDCD4 was increased in vascular endothelial cells treated by Kawasaki disease serum[mRNA:(1.00±0.01)vs.(3.51±0.36); protein:(0.26±0.08)vs.(0.57±0.06)] .PDCD4 siRNA can reduce the expression level of PDCD4 in vascular endothelial cells[mRNA:(0.91±0.09)vs.(0.41±0.06); protein:(0.65±0.08)vs.(0.30±0.05)] .Compared with those treated with vehicle,the proliferation of vascular endothelial cells after treatment with Kawasaki disease serum decreased[(100.00±0.00)% vs.(72.01±7.32)%],the rate of apoptosis increased[(6.32±0.58)% vs.(21.26±2.31)%],the level of C?Caspase?3 and C?Caspase?9 protein in cells increased.Downregulation of PDCD4 could enhance the proliferation of vascular endothelial cells in Kawasaki disease[(71.57±9.05)% vs.(89.52±6.80)%],reduce apoptosis[(22.58±1.79)% vs.(16.47±1.24)%]and expression of C?Caspase?3 and C?Caspase?9 protein in cells. Conclusion Downregulation of PDCD4 reduces apoptosis of vascular endothelial cells induced by serum from Kawasaki disease.
